#133518 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#133518 is composed of 7.5% red, 20.8% green and 9.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 54.7% yellow and 79.2% black. It has a hue angle of 128.8 degrees, a saturation of 47.2% and a lightness of 14.1%. #133518 color hex could be obtained by blending #266a30 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003300.

Shades and Tints of #133518

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030a04 is the darkest color, while #fafdf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#133518

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#242424 is the less saturated color, while #02460c is the most saturated one.
